The study based on multiple selection criteria in F2 population of six rice crosses revealed the desirable responses in most of the characters under study in F3 generation. However, nonsignificant values of intergeneration rank correlation and best vs worst variance ratio indicated the absence of response to selection on the basis of grain yield per se. Further selections in two crosses, N22 X FH109 and N22 X IET 1444, are expected to give better responses in succeeding generation.
